Tang Soo Do Karate
A traditional Korean martial art, Tang Soo Do combines kicks, strikes, blocks, and is a powerful tool for self-defense as well as artistic expression through combative movement. Training also results in the development of individual character, discipline, respect, and physical fitness.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(BJJ)
BJJ emphasizes grappling, ground fighting, take downs, and submission holds and is a crucial component of a well-rounded set of self-defense skills. Kali-Eskrima
Eskrima is a traditional Filipino martial art, which focuses on weapons-based fighting including sticks, blades, and “improvised” weapons, as well as empty hand techniques. It complements and enhances both our striking and grappling martial arts. The Kampilan style was developed by Guro Edie Mesina over decades of training and practical application. Muay Thai
Known as "the art of eight limbs," Muay Thai is a total body training discipline that will teach you how to gain an edge over an opponent using any means possible. Our Muay Thai Classes at National Martial Arts will help you develop serious total body strength while helping you learn how to efficiently strike using any part of your body. Muay Thai is the national sport and chosen martial art of Thailand. Fighters use strikes from their:
- Fists
- Feet
- Knees
- Elbows
- Shins
...to defeat an opponent. Muay Thai Offers Cardiovascular Training That Is Unparalleled. One of the many elements of a successful Muay Thai strategy is using movement and agility to gain an edge on your opponent. The close-combat discipline keeps fighters in close quarters throughout a bout but every movement is vital and calculated.
